Dependency Ratios for US ZIP Code 78654

Total Dependency Ratio:
84.3
Youth Dependency:
42.2
Old-Age Dependency:
42.1

The dependency ratio measures dependents (ages 0-17 and 65+) per 100 working-age individuals (ages 18-64).
